MP Mahindananda Aluthgamage, who was arrested, released on bail and then remanded, is seen being taken to remand custody from the Fort Magistrate’s Court. Meanwhile, unlike previous occasions, the police had prevented the photojournalists from entering into the Court premises yesterday. Pix by Pradeep Dilrukshana
